NSHTOU PUR Low Voltage Reeling Cable

This kind of cable combines the advantages of reduced size, lightweight, high chemical resistance, Waterproof, Mineral Oil resistance, Salt spray resistance,high mechanical properties and so on.

It is recommended for installation in railway vehicles (locomotives, trains, trolley busses), port machine and other industrial equipment for power supply.

    Construction

    Conductor : Flexible Bare copper Class6/tinned copper 

    Insulation: PUR/Special Rubber compound/on request

    Shield: Tinned copper braid or on request

    Sheath : PUR/Special Rubber compound/on request

    Colors: Black, Yellow, Grey, or on reques

    Other Structure Can Be Customized As Your Need

    Electric Parameter

    Standard: IEC VDE0295 CLASS 6  

    Min. bending radius: 8-10 x outer diameter 

    Temperature:  Fixed: -40℃~120℃   move: -30℃~90℃

    Normal Voltage: 450/750V, 600/1000V 

    Test Voltage: 3500V-5000V

    Certification: ISO,CE,CCC

    Advantages: Flexible, abrasion resistance, tension resistance, Oil resistance, Flame retardant(optional), UV-Resistance,chemical resistance,

    This design ensures that non corrosive and low toxic gases are emitted in case of fire.
